Serif Normal Veman 8 is a light, normal width, very high cont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A high-contrast serif with slender hairlines, fuller main strokes, and sharply defined, wedge-like terminals. The serifs are delicate and crisp, with an overall vertical, composed stance and generous counters that keep the page color bright despite the contrast. Uppercase forms feel stately and spacious, while the lowercase maintains a traditional text rhythm with clean joins, restrained curves, and tidy, punctuated details (notably round i/j dots). Numerals follow the same refined logic, mixing strong verticals with thin connecting strokes for an elegant, display-friendly texture.

Well suited to magazine and book typography where a refined, high-contrast serif can carry headlines, pull quotes, and section openers with elegance. It also fits branding and packaging in luxury-adjacent contexts, such as fashion, beauty, hospitality, and cultural institutions. In digital or print layouts, it will shine when given adequate size and spacing to preserve its thin details.

This typeface conveys a refined, cultured tone with a distinctly editorial feel. The crisp contrast and poised proportions suggest sophistication, formality, and a touch of fashion-oriented elegance. Overall, it reads as confident and polished rather than casual.

The design appears intended to deliver a classic serif reading experience with heightened contrast for sophistication and presence. It aims to look authoritative in headlines while still maintaining conventional proportions and recognizable letterforms that support extended setting. The controlled sharpness and consistent stroke logic indicate an emphasis on polished typography and high-end presentation.

The sample text shows strong word-shape continuity and a calm vertical rhythm, with crisp punctuation and a pronounced contrast pattern that becomes especially striking in large sizes. Curved letters (like C, S, and O) show smooth modulation, while diagonals (like V, W, and X) keep thin junctions that benefit from careful reproduction and sufficient resolution.
